Eminem: The Rap Legend's Evolution in 2023-2024
Eminem, real name Marshall Bruce Mathers III, is a legendary hip-hop artist. Eminem, known for his fast-paced delivery, sophisticated wordplay, and highly personal lyrics.
Genres and Musical Styles
Eminem's music is predominantly rap and hip-hop. His approach is distinguished by an unusual combination of powerful beats, sophisticated lyrics, and a brutally honest story. He has experimented with several sub-genres and cooperated with a wide range of artists.The Years of Activity
Eminem's career skyrocketed in the late 1990s with his breakout album, "The Slim Shady LP" (1999). Since then, he has been a dominant force in the music industry, constantly adapting his sound and lyrical substance to remain relevant in a rapidly shifting musical scene. Eminem's music during 2023-2024 period demonstrates his ability to adapt and create while remaining faithful to his roots. Song Lyrics: Features, Meaning, and Mood
. Eminem's songs are noted for conveying real emotion and vivid storytelling. For example, in his song "Lose Yourself," he raps: "Look, if you had one shot, or one opportunity / To seize everything you ever wanted, in one moment / Would you capture it, or just let it slip?" These words capture the intensity and pressure of grasping opportunities, a common topic in his music. Eminem's impact on listeners is significant. Many followers take comfort in his candid depiction of personal challenges and resilience. His ability to express pain, fury, and redemption strikes a chord with a large audience. However, his career has not been free of scandal. Eminem has received criticism for his sexual content and provocative topics. Critics frequently dispute the influence of his music on cultural standards and ideals.Awards and recognition
Eminem's contributions to music have received widespread recognition. He has received numerous accolades, including multiple Grammys, an Academy Award for Best Original Song for "Lose Yourself," and several MTV Music Awards.
